H. Talvitie et al., IMPROVED FREQUENCY STABILITY OF AN EXTERNAL-CAVITY DIODE-LASER BY ELIMINATING TEMPERATURE AND PRESSURE EFFECTS, Applied optics, 35(21), 1996, pp. 4166-4168
The construction of a passively stabilized external cavity diode laser
operating at 780 nm is reported. The sensitivity of laser frequency t
o changes in air pressure was studied and subsequently eliminated. The
relative frequency stability obtained was 4 x 10(-9) for an integrati
on time of 4000 s. (C) 1996 Optical Society of America
